Assistant Project Manager (Construction)

6 Month Contract

Bristol (3 days onsite)

Day Rate C.£450 (Inside IR35)



About Us

Our organization plays a key role in supporting communities and individuals across the UK. Our Places Team is at the forefront of implementing our Group Location Strategy, Branch Strategy, and Sustainability Programmes. We collaborate with various teams—ranging from Design and Construction to Sustainability and Asset Management—to create exceptional spaces that reflect our dedication to inclusivity and sustainability.



About the Role

As the Assistant Project Manager within our Places Team, you will support the Regional Delivery Manager in executing transformative projects that align with our Group Strategy. You will be instrumental in ensuring that we deliver outstanding environments for our customers and colleagues.



What You’ll Do:

  • Support the Regional Delivery Manager in managing and delivering multi-million-pound projects.
  • Assist in change management efforts, driving excellent outcomes in a fast-paced environment.
  • Collaborate with various stakeholders, including external third parties, to ensure seamless project execution.
  • Utilize your analytical skills to produce reports and data insights that inform project planning.
  • Employ risk management strategies to support project delivery within established cost, time, and quality parameters.
  • Contribute creative solutions and problem-solving approaches to overcome challenges.



What We’re Looking For:

  • Experience in a project/change management support role.
  • Strong analytical and organizational skills, with the ability to manage complex data sets.
  • Exceptional communication skills, with the ability to adapt your style to suit different audiences.
  • A knack for creative problem-solving and a passion for delivering impactful results.
  • Understanding of risk-based decision-making within a governance framework.
  • A commitment to fostering positive, sustainable, and inclusive work environments.
  • A growth mindset, eager to learn and develop further in your career.
  • Proficiency in MS Word, Excel, and PowerPoint is essential.
